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16175 1121 97807286 6772216 16023
980482943 06439
980482943 06439
1595305 44978 70608 4793381
All about undefined
Interested in learning more?
980482943 06439
1595305 44978 70608 4793381
See more
3675583 5704 6002
96310 8117555 8369862
See more
01147 708585480
26316616228 4180080 03 160 713480
See more